Trying to get the stang all track ready for this weekend. my brakes for some reason are acting up. start the car and at idel i have plenty of pedall when i start driveing the car and try to stop i dont have that great of pedal it almost's goes to the floor. i checked break fluid its full and nice and clean....

The other thing i noticed was that on the driver rear side i took the drum off and theres a small cable inside that is broken..Not the ebrake cable..so im guessing i need a new spring kit do think that could be the problem
#6
RE: I hate breaks
That's for the self adjuster. Start by putting some new drums on and bleeding. If the pedalwill still eventually go to the floor with constant pressure with no leaks - you likely have a bad master cylinder. Lucky for you - it is a cheapeasy thing to replace and will give you a great opportunity to change out your super nasty half-waterteenage brake fluid!
Worst case scenario - a Hundred bucks, a case of beer and a half a day later you got new shoes, a new master and fresh fluid front to back.
